I saw that also. However, he doesn't state what is wrong. I got a 551xxx yesterday. I've only been able to test for a day. I've never as much problem as others on a 534xxx body, but I have seen AI Servo ranges with shots OOF in them. In very limited testing the 551xxx body has been spot on. I can't say the problem has been fixed, but so far I don't see any problem.

I wouldn't jump to conclusions based on one post with no explanation of what they are seeing and no shots. There are other posts with shots saying it's working fine.
